|
@@ -99,7 +99,7 @@ public class SysCouponCodeServiceImpl extends BaseServiceImpl<Long, SysCouponCod
|
|
|
couponCodes.add(couponCode);
|
|
|
}
|
|
|
sysCouponCodeDao.batchInsert(couponCodes);
|
|
|
- sysCoupon.setConsumeNum(new AtomicInteger(sysCoupon.getConsumeNum()).incrementAndGet());
|
|
|
+ sysCoupon.setConsumeNum(new AtomicInteger(sysCoupon.getConsumeNum()).addAndGet(exchangeNum));
|
|
|
if(sysCoupon.getWarningStatus()==0&&sysCoupon.getStockCount()!=-1&&sysCoupon.getStockCount()-sysCoupon.getConsumeNum()<sysCoupon.getWarningStockNum()){
|
|
|
sysCouponService.stockWarning(sysCoupon.getId(), sysCoupon.getName());
|
|
|
sysCoupon.setWarningStatus(1);
|